The target of ezetimibe is Niemann-Pick C1-Like 1 (NPC1L1).

TL;DR: A binding assay is developed and shown that labeled ezetimibe glucuronide binds specifically to a single site in brush border membranes and to human embryonic kidney 293 cells expressing NPC1L1, which unequivocally establish NPC1 L1 as the direct target of ezETimibe and should facilitate efforts to identify the molecular mechanism of cholesterol transport.
